| Year | Average price | Sales |
|---|---|---|
| 1995 | £27,128 | 320 |
| 1996 | £25,809 | 323 |
| 1997 | £24,622 | 320 |
| 1998 | £25,569 | 343 |
| 1999 | £21,732 | 340 |
| 2000 | £20,068 | 389 |
| 2001 | £21,596 | 508 |
| 2002 | £23,964 | 624 |
| 2003 | £27,870 | 760 |
| 2004 | £46,642 | 856 |
| 2005 | £58,252 | 722 |
| 2006 | £67,709 | 691 |
| 2007 | £72,840 | 692 |
| 2008 | £71,266 | 361 |
| 2009 | £69,904 | 151 |
| 2010 | £64,057 | 183 |
| 2011 | £63,216 | 187 |
| 2012 | £59,560 | 167 |
| 2013 | £57,145 | 193 |
| 2014 | £54,275 | 180 |
| 2015 | £54,613 | 162 |
| 2016 | £57,664 | 144 |
| 2017 | £53,116 | 171 |
| 2018 | £53,018 | 164 |
| 2019 | £53,428 | 140 |
| 2020 | £51,002 | 121 |
| 2021 | £57,063 | 189 |
| 2022 | £66,578 | 175 |
| 2023 | £74,188 | 112 |
| 2024 | £67,387 | 108 |
| 2025 | £74,530 | 114 |
| 2026 | £75,828 | 20 |

How we calculate these figures
Figures use HM Land Registry Price Paid Data, standard sales only (their 'category A' - excludes repossessions, transfers not for value and buy-to-let portfolio deals), and ignore entries under £1,000. England and Wales only; Land Registry publishes with a 1-2 month lag.
- Average price
- The arithmetic mean of every recorded sale in the TS1 district, all property types and all years since 1995 combined. Spanning decades, it typically sits below current values - see the year-by-year trend for the recent level.
- Total sales
- A straight count of the standard sales recorded in the district, with the dates of the first and most recent.
- Lowest / highest sale
- The single lowest and highest individual sale prices recorded in the district in any year - two transactions, not a typical range.
- Trend (% change & chart)
- We compare the average price in this district's earliest year that had at least 10 recorded sales with its most recent such year. Years with very few sales are skipped so the trend is not thrown by one-off transactions.
- Street averages
- Each street average is the mean of that street's standard sales across all years. Streets with very few sales can look unusually high or low.
- Property-type mix
- Share of standard sales by property type across the TS1 district. Any new-build figure compares the average new-build price with the average existing-home price, weighted by number of sales.
- Instant estimate
- An automated estimate from nearby Land Registry sold prices adjusted for market trends - not a formal valuation. A local agent's valuation will be more accurate.
- Change since previous sale
- Where a sale row shows "up/down X% since {year}", that compares the sale price with the most recent earlier recorded sale of the same property - not an area trend.
